The Samsung OM75P-21-ESGN is a genuine 1000-watt microwave magnetron operating at 2450 MHz, designed to fit multiple Samsung and Kenmore microwave models. Engineered for reliable, even heating, this factory-tested stainless steel component restores your microwave’s core heating function, offering a cost-effective alternative to full appliance replacement.

The over the counter Samsung microwave thats been going strong since we got it 4 yrs ago stopped heating food and it was making an unusual sound Called Samsung support on this as I was assuming it was the magnetron that went bad and info I had was this was under warranty for 5yrs. Well it is, but only the part. You have to pay for the tech to install it, and a few other fees that makes it not worth it to install. And they would not send it to me so I could do it. So I watched a few youtube videos and am comfortable fixing home appliances. So thought I would give it a go. Honestly, the hardest part in all of this was unmounting it from the wall and then reinstall it. The removal of the magnetron was really easy. Getting to it and taking all the outer screws out on the case was a bit much but totally doable. Just keep them in order as there are different ones. There is a SAFETY ISSUE so you do not electrocute yourself or get seriously injured. I left mine unplugged for 3 days so the capacitor could self discharge. Or there are videos to self discharge this. Also get ready for the grease show. I went though a bunch of cleaning wipes as the outer case and inside had grease all over so good time to get in there and clean it out. And if you have not changed the charcoal filter along the top or cleaned the two filters underneath might be a good time to do that too. Overall aside from waiting the 3 days I had this all done in about an hour.

My microwave started making a horrible buzzing sound and stopped heating. After some research, I found that this was a common failure point for the symptoms I was having. Replacement was relatively easy. About 20 screws total and then the panel comes off and the part is easily accessible. $100 vs $500 for a new unit.
